Wing Yip Food Holdings Group Limited American Depositary Shares (WYHG) recently released its official Q1 2025 earnings results, marking the latest public financial disclosures available for the ethnic food distribution and retail firm. The reported results include GAAP earnings per share (EPS) of $0.23 and total quarterly revenue of $144,629,055 for the specified quarter. Management Commentary
During the associated earnings call held shortly after the results were published, WYHG leadership shared key insights driving the quarter’s performance. Management noted that investments in supply chain redundancy implemented over prior periods helped mitigate potential disruptions to product sourcing and last-mile delivery during Q1 2025, supporting consistent service levels for both retail and commercial clients. They also highlighted that rising consumer interest in diverse, authentic ethnic cuisine contributed to steady demand across core product categories during the quarter, particularly for products positioned for at-home cooking and small catering use cases. Leadership also acknowledged that incremental labor costs in certain high-traffic distribution hubs put mild pressure on operating margins during Q1 2025, a trend they are actively addressing through targeted operational efficiency initiatives including route optimization and automated inventory management rollouts.

Forward Guidance
WYHG’s management did not issue formal quantitative financial guidance for future periods during the call, in line with the firm’s longstanding standard disclosure practices. However, leadership noted that they see potential for continued demand momentum across their core operating regions as consumer preference for diverse food options remains sustained. They also flagged several potential headwinds that could impact future performance, including volatility in global agricultural commodity prices, evolving cross-border import regulations for perishable food products, and fluctuating foreign exchange rates for markets outside the U.S. Management emphasized that they are continuing to monitor these factors closely and adjust operational plans as needed, without offering any definitive projections for future financial performance.

Market Reaction
Following the public release of WYHG’s Q1 2025 earnings results, the stock traded with moderate volume in subsequent sessions, with price action reflecting mixed market sentiment. Some sell-side analysts have noted that the reported EPS and revenue figures align closely with their base case projections for the quarter, while others have highlighted the potential margin headwinds cited by management as an area for ongoing monitoring. Based on recent market data, the broader consumer staples and specialty food distribution sector has seen mixed performance this month, a trend that may also be contributing to WYHG’s recent trading dynamics. Institutional holdings data shows that the stock is primarily held by consumer staples focused mutual funds and niche ESG investors focused on diverse supply chain businesses.
